Abandoned Cart Emails: Strategies for Bringing Customers Back

Recovering missed sales through abandoned cart emails is a vital tactic for boosting your e-commerce revenue . These emails, strategically crafted, act as a gentle reminder to shoppers who started the checkout process but didn't finish their purchase. A winning approach involves more than just a simple “you forgot something” message. Consider segmenting your audience; for instance, offering a modest discount or free shipping to new customers, while presenting alternative options or highlighting the benefits of the product to loyal customers. You might also check here include clear calls to action, such as a direct link back to their cart, alongside compelling product pictures and perhaps a reassuring statement about your protected payment process.

  • Personalize some email with the shopper's name .
  • Use a sequence of emails – a first friendly reminder, followed by a subsequent email with an incentive.
  • Ensure your emails are responsive.
Ultimately, the goal is to win back those would-be customers and turn those abandoned carts into completed orders.

Understanding Cart Abandonment: Reasons & Solutions

Cart abandonment, that frustrating phenomenon where shoppers put in their online shopping cart and then leave without finalising the buy, is a significant challenge for e-online retail businesses. Several factors contribute to this, including unexpected shipping fees, a complicated checkout procedure, missing trust signals like security badges, or simply shoppers window shopping without immediate purchase intention. To tackle this, businesses can implement solutions like recovery emails, streamlined checkout options, transparent pricing, and establish trust through testimonials and secure payment processes. Ultimately, lowering cart abandonment requires a overall approach to the shopping process.
